Opening the incubator isn't to be recommended, but I have had the incubator open and shut a number of times with chicks that are stuck without obvious determent. If I have to hatch a chick, though, I usually do it on a paper towel soaked with warm water.
So......if you have to open, don't beat yourself up about it, shut the incubator as soon as you can and assume the rest will be OK,
